Title
The analysis of the precision about the measured horizontal electric field from LEMP

Abstract
Because of an inherent difficulty in measuring the horizontal electric field component from lightning, we have discussed, used FDTD method, the overshadowing effect of the vertical electric field component, depending on the distance to the lightning channel, the ground conductivity, and the height of the observation point. By numerical simulations, the resulting peak errors of the horizontal electric field for different sensor tilt are calculated and the main factors contaminating the horizontal electric field are referred.
